<p>Gallbladder cancer is a common malignancy of biliary tract that often presents at an advanced stage due to its aggressive behaviour and is associated with poor prognosis and reduced survival. It most frequently metastasizes to the liver and regional lymph nodes, while metastasis to the breast is exceedingly rare. Here, we report an extremely rare case of synchronous gallbladder carcinoma with breast metastasis in a 60-year-old female, confirmed by histopathology, immunohistochemistry, Contrast Enhanced Computed Tomography scan (CECT) and tumour marker evaluation. Owing to the typically poor prognosis and a median survival of less than one year, management is mainly palliative, with emphasis on symptom relief and improvement in quality of life. In the present case, the patient showed a favourable response to palliative chemotherapy with gemcitabine and cisplatin, achieving symptomatic improvement, and an overall survival of 14 months from the initiation of treatment. Literature describing gallbladder carcinoma with metastasis to the breast remains extremely limited.</p>
